Broken crank snout in a VG motor

Has anyone here ever seen this happen?

I have a 93 GXE with a broken crankshaft. Took me and a buddy forever to find the problem. The car would actually still run, although not very well. Finally noticed the crank pulley was wobbling during a compression check, which yielded numbers like 75PSI across the board. When the crank bolt was removed, the end of the crank just fell off.

Obviously this engine is junk now. I think it would be way too much trouble to replace the crank in a 192K motor when a salvage yard replacement will be nearly as cheap.

most likely the accessory belts were over tightened or possibly it had been hit somehow in the past. either way, i'd just go to a salvage yard and pick one up for a couple hundred dollars, swap it in, and call it a day.

i've heard of that happening before and that's definitely one of the few ways to destroy a vg. otherwise these engines are absolutely awesome and nearly indestructible.
